Grasping Round Shapes : Calculating The Distance Around

To truly grasp circles, you need to examine their fundamental properties. Among these is the circumference – the length of the boundary . Calculating it is straightforward once you know the relationship. The circumference (C) is determined by two times pi (π), a unique value approximately equal to 3.14159, multiplied by the radius (r) – so C = 2πr. Or you can use the diameter (d), which is twice the radius, and the formula becomes C = πd.
